Water Resources Associate / Review Engineer

Michael Baker International
Posted 2 hours ago
🇺🇸United States🏢Hybrid💰$68.5K–$98.9K📁Engineering & Development

WATER PRACTICE Michael Baker International’s Water Group provides innovative consulting, planning and engineering solutions for the entire spectrum of the water cycle. We have proven experience in providing a full range of professional services from scientific and technical analysis, concept through design, and construction support services. Protection and management of water resources starts at the watershed level and follows the movement of water through urban and agricultural areas, streams, lakes and reservoirs, water distribution systems, wastewater collection systems, and water/wastewater treatment plants. What We're Looking For: Michael Baker International is seeking a highly motivated, early-career Water Resources Associate / Review Engineer to join our growing team in Lakewood, CO . This position is open to both hybrid and remote work. In this role, you will work alongside experienced engineers and serve as a primary technical liaison between private developers, municipal partners, and federal agencies, making this a uniquely visible and impactful role. This position offers the opportunity to develop your technical skills while receiving hands on mentorship from senior engineers and project managers. This is an excellent opportunity for an early-career engineer ready to take on meaningful technical responsibility, expand their expertise in water resources and floodplain engineering, and grow within a nationally recognized firm committed to developing its people. This position is ideal for an engineer looking to build a strong technical foundation while gaining broad exposure to hydraulic and hydrologic modeling, flood hazard analysis, floodplain management, and GIS mapping. What You'll Do: You will be actively engaged in the technical review, analysis, and coordination of flood studies, development projects, and regulatory processes. Day-to-day responsibilities include: Technical Review & Analysis — Provide detailed technical review and written comment on flood studies, master planning documents, engineering plans, specifications, and reports for a wide variety of development projects located within regulatory floodplains, ensuring compliance with applicable safety standards and regulations. Regulatory Coordination & Compliance — Ensure proposed projects adhere to applicable federal, state, and local codes, laws, rules, regulations, specifications, standards, and procedures, with a focus on National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) requirements. FEMA Letter of Map Change (LOMC) Support — Provide technical guidance and support to community officials, floodplain managers, private applicants, and consultants navigating the LOMC application and amendment process with FEMA. Stakeholder Collaboration — Act as a technical liaison and collaborate with applicants, project managers, consultants, contractors, and community staff to identify and resolve outstanding technical, regulatory, or political issues that arise during the review process. Project & Schedule Management — Manage workload, monitor project schedules, and track performance to ensure timely and accurate delivery of review comments and project milestones. Deliverable Quality Control — Review technical writing, mapping attachments, tables, and figures within final project deliverables to verify technical accuracy and ensure professional, client-ready work products. What You Need to Succeed: 4-year deg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ering required 0-2 years' experience in hydrologic & hydraulic modeling and mapping, floodplain management, watershed modeling. EIT certification or ability to obtain within 6 months of hire required. Knowledge of the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) preferred. Must have strong written and verbal communication skills. We are searching for candidates that have the ability to be a role model among peers, that are people and client-focused, and those are looking for a growth opportunity into a management position. Compensation: The approximate compensation range for this position is $68,493 - $98,887 per year. This compensation range is a good faith estimate for the position at the time of posting. Actual compensation is dependent upon factors such as education, qualifications, experience, skillset, and physical work location. Why Choose Us: Medical, dental, vision insurance 401k Retirement Plan Health Savings Account (HSA) Flexible Spending Account (FSA) Life, AD&D, short-term, and long-term disability Professional and personal development Generous paid time off Commuter and wellness benefits
